Charlie's Blog #41: Words I've looked up recently

Words I've looked up recently

Of late I've become quite an aficionado of the dictionary. There are an astounding number of words we all think we know the meanings of, that we really don't. We think we've figured them out from context, and may even use them in our own speech. However if you start to question how sure you are of what any word really means, and start looking them up, I think you will be amazed at how many words you had wrong. I certainly was. I still am.
